SHARED CONTEXT WORKSPACE

People and agents work
from the same live context.

Specialized agents investigate different parts of a problem and add source-backed observations, relationships, policy decisions, predictions, and proposals to one durable enterprise record.

People join that same workspace, see the context their role permits, inspect how the conclusion was assembled, and authorize consequential action.

TRUST AND DEPLOYMENT

Trust is enforced
before the answer.

  1. 01

    PERMISSIONS BEFORE RETRIEVAL

    Alef applies access controls before it reads, not after it answers.

  2. 02

    FACTS REMAIN DISTINCT

    Observed evidence and predicted conclusions never share the same status.

  3. 03

    DECISIONS REMAIN ATTACHED

    Evidence, approval, execution, reversal, and outcome form one durable record.
